Which of the following are true about the Cuban Missile Crisis? Select all that apply. Question 1 options:

The Soviet Union placing missiles in Cuba that threatened the United States.

The United States “quarantined” Cuba using military vessels.

The Soviets agreed to remove the missiles from Cuba when the United States agreed to remove their own missiles from Turkey.

The Cuban Missile Crisis is an example of the constant standoff between the United States and the Soviet Union during the Cold War.
